Kang and Kodos Johnson [1] are a duo of fictional recurring characters in the animated television series The Simpsons. Kang is voiced by Harry Shearer and Kodos by Dan Castellaneta . They are green, perpetually drooling, octopus -like aliens from the fictional planet Rigel VII and appear almost exclusively in the " Treehouse of Horror " episodes.

Although Kang and Kodos make brief appearances in every Treehouse of Horror episode, their brief appearance in this one was nearly cut. David X. Cohen managed to persuade the producers to leave the scene in. [3]
Brighton Collectibles (Brighton) is a dual American accessories manufacturer-retailer headquartered in City of Industry, California, USA. Brighton Collectibles owns 180 retail stores worldwide and an online shop. Some of their factories are located in Guangdong province in China, a manufacturing hub for handbags and leather goods. [1]
